您的位置:首页 >JSP项目如何在Ubuntu上进行版本控制
发布于2026-05-03 阅读(0)
扫一扫,手机访问
在Ubuntu系统上管理JSP项目,Git无疑是版本控制的首选工具。它不仅能帮你追踪每一次代码变更,更是团队协作的基石。下面这份操作指南,将带你一步步完成从本地初始化到远程协作的全过程。
万事开头先装工具。打开终端,运行下面这两条命令,确保你的系统拥有最新的Git。
sudo apt update
sudo apt install git
安装完成后,就可以进入你的JSP项目根目录,让它变成一个Git可以管理的仓库。操作非常简单:
cd /path/to/your/jsp/project
git init
看到“Initialized empty Git repository”的提示,就说明本地仓库已经创建好了。
接下来,需要把项目里的文件都交给Git来照看。使用下面的命令,可以将当前目录下的所有文件(包括子目录)添加到暂存区:
git add .
文件添加后,需要做一个正式的“存档”,这就是提交(commit)。为你的项目第一个版本留个言吧:
git commit -m "Initial commit"
这里的提交信息“Initial commit”就像给这个版本贴的标签,建议写得清晰明了。
本地存档固然好,但代码放在云端才更安全、更便于协作。以GitHub为例,创建一个远程仓库只需几步:
本地和云端需要建立连接。将上一步创建的远程仓库地址,添加为本地仓库的远程源(通常命名为origin):
git remote add origin https://github.com/your-username/your-repository.git
请务必将链接中的“your-username”和“your-repository”替换成你自己的信息。
关联之后,就可以将本地提交的代码推送到远程仓库了。第一次推送时,记得加上-u参数来建立追踪:
git push -u origin master
现在,你的代码就已经安全地托管在GitHub上了。
日常开发中,你会反复用到以下几个核心命令:
添加变更:当你修改了文件或新增了文件,需要将它们添加到暂存区。
git add 提交更改:为本次的修改创建一个新的版本记录。
git commit -m "Your commit message"推送更改:将本地的提交同步到远程仓库。
git push origin master拉取更新:如果团队其他成员推送了代码,你需要将其拉取到本地以保持同步。
git pull origin master直接在主分支上开发风险不小,更好的实践是使用分支。比如,想开发一个新功能,可以新建并切换到一个分支:
git branch new-feature
git checkout new-feature
或者,更简洁地用一条命令:git checkout -b new-feature。功能开发测试完毕后,再合并回主分支:
git checkout master
git merge new-feature
git push origin master
.gitignore文件项目里总有些文件是不需要版本控制的,比如编译生成的*.class文件、target/目录或者IDE的配置文件。这时,一个.gitignore文件就非常必要了。在项目根目录创建它,并添加需要忽略的规则:
echo "*.class" >> .gitignore
echo "target/" >> .gitignore
这样,当你执行git add .时,这些文件就会被自动排除在外。
遵循以上步骤,你就能在Ubuntu上为JSP项目建立起一套规范的Git版本控制流程。核心要义在于:养成“小步快走,频繁提交”的习惯,并及时将本地提交推送到远程仓库。这套实践不仅能让你从容回溯历史,更是实现高效团队协作的可靠保障。
售后无忧
立即购买>office旗舰店
售后无忧
立即购买>office旗舰店
售后无忧
立即购买>office旗舰店
售后无忧
立即购买>office旗舰店
正版软件
正版软件
正版软件
正版软件
正版软件
1
2
3
7
9